Holy smokes that's a lot of Coves! Really nice fleet. Maybe I can help with the Devinci. Devinci is from Quebec, and extremely popular there, they like to "buy French". Their factory is directly across the road from a mine, the product is 100% Canadian. They build nice aluminum frames, but were known to skimp out on components.
